Primary Function of Position
Reporting to the Sr. Customs and Logistics Manager, the Customs Supervisor is responsible for ensuring customs compliance, operational efficiency, and seamless import/export processes. This role leads the logistics team and coordinates with customs brokers, carriers, and other service providers, ensuring adherence to Mexican and international customs regulations.
Essential Job Duties
- Supervise daily import, export, and virtual customs operations.
- Ensure accuracy and integrity of import export documentation, HS classification, and recordkeeping.
- Maintain compliance with Mexican customs regulations, trade programs, Intuitive certifications, and relevant international regulations.
- Oversee inventory control compliance related to Annex 24 and IMMEX programs.
- Manage internal audits and support external audits.
- Oversee key performance indicators (KPIs) for brokers, carriers, and third‑party logistics providers (3PLs) to support daily activities.
- Track shipments end-to-end, manage expedited shipments, and resolve operational issues.
- Supervises a team of individual contributors with responsibility for performing functions related to the Raw Material and FG Import/Export, besides other requests, according to documented procedures.
- Train, mentor, and develop team members.
- Assign workloads and set priorities within the team.
- Conduct regular team performance evaluations.
- Escalate operational performance matters and project updates to the supervisor.
- Foster a culture of compliance and continuous improvement.
- Drive process and system enhancements, including automation initiatives.
- Report, control, and monitor KPIs (e.g., clearance times,
operational efficiency, costs, compliance).
- Manage and review international documentation required for shipments.
- Address and elevate customs‑related requests and inquiries as necessary.
- Create, update, and analyze import/export reports.
Required Skills and Experience
- Proficiency in Excel and Microsoft Office applications.
- Advanced English language skills (verbal and written).
- Extensive experience and knowledge in:
- Customs legal framework, including customs regime operations, general rules of foreign trade, and virtual/definitive/temporary operations.
- Recordkeeping requirements.
- Data analysis and reporting from Customs Inventory System (Annex 24).
- Scrap management and exportation.
- Customs clearance and international logistics/transportation.
- Import/export operations for equipment, spare parts, raw materials, finished goods, and scrap.
- FDA & COFEPRIS controls and regulatory compliance.
- Resolving issues with service providers.
- Addressing customs requests and inquiries.
- Equipment inventory management and tracking.
- Operations under VAT, AEO, and CTPAT certifications.
- High-volume logistics operations.
Required Education and Training
- Minimum 3 years of experience in leadership roles within customs/logistics operations.
- Bachelor’s degree in International Trade, Logistics, or a related field.
- Experience with IMMEX, HTS classification, and ERP systems.
- Strong leadership and analytical skills.
Working Conditions
- Access to areas where appropriate personal protective equipment (PPE) is required, including footwear, eye protection, and other safety gear as necessary.
